Teamsters Endorse Barack Obama
"Senator Obama will stand with the Teamsters when it comes to fighting for working families," said General President Jim Hoffa. The endorsement mobilizes the union's 1.4 million members and their families to elect the Illinois senator.

More Than 5,800 UPS Freight Workers Sign Authorization Cards to Become Teamsters
The Teamsters’ campaign to organize UPS Freight workers gains more momentum as an overwhelming majority of workers at the company’s terminals throughout the country recently signed authorization cards to unionize. Check out which workers have recently made the choice to become Teamsters, bringing the total number of UPS Freight drivers and dockworkers joining the union to nearly 5,830 in less than six weeks.

New Era Cap Workers in Mobile Unanimously Ratify First Contract
Teamsters at New Era Cap in Mobile, Alabama unanimously ratified their first contract following a seven-month struggle with the company.

Black History is Teamster History
The contributions of black members to the success of the Teamsters Union are numerous, varied and as old as the union itself. Black team drivers attended the first Convention in 1903 and were active in all aspects of the union, including leadership, from the beginning. That commitment remains strong today.

Teamsters Demand That OSHA Issue Emergency Standard on Combustible Dust
The Teamsters Union joined with the United Food and Commercial Workers in calling on the Occupational Health and Safety Administration (OSHA) to issue an emergency standard on combustible dust following last week’s deadly explosion at a sugar plant in Georgia.

First Transit Bus Drivers at Emory University Join Union
In the first of nine elections at Atlanta-area First Transit locations scheduled in February alone, bus operators at Emory University unanimously voted to be represented by Local 728.


Union Demands Overhaul of Compensation Practices at UAL   
The Teamsters sent a letter Tuesday to UAL Corporation demanding that it overhaul its compensation practices. If the company makes no significant changes, the International Brotherhood of Teamsters General Fund will urge fellow shareholders to withhold votes from directors serving on the subcommittee that set UAL’s exorbitant executive pay.
